ATLANTA:
Cable TV equipment vendor Scientific Atlanta has developed
a new system that it says significantly increases bandwidth
efficiency.
The PowerVu(r) advanced modulator (model D9390T) with 8PSK
Turbo Code will increase bit rates, which is used to expand
the number of channels that can be delivered by a single
transponder, an official release says.
Scientific-Atlanta claims the new system will help companies
offer more digital services and programming, such as HD
and IP data, while also conserving bandwidth.
In a performance comparison conducted by Scientific-Atlanta,
changing from QPSK to 8PSK using Turbo Code in an existing
network, throughput was increased by more than 30 per cent.
This frees up more transponder space for additional programming,
or even may allow the programmer or broadcaster to lease
the extra space to generate more revenue, the release says.
When combined with the PowerVu professional receiver (model
D9224), the PowerVu advanced modulator will deliver a powerful
end-to-end solution for maximizing bandwidth and significantly
lowering the cost of delivering more digital programming.
The PowerVu professional receiver is one of a series of
Scientific-Atlanta MPEG-2/DVB digital compression products
designed for broadcast and professional applications requiring
4:2:0/4:2:2 decoding. The receiver offers features such
as the capability to receive digitally encrypted video,
audio, utility data, IP data, VBI, teletext and conditional
access.
